Stephanie Trend
I completed a BSc with honours at the University of Western Australia in 2006, and have worked in diagnostic microbiology laboratories as well as in oncology clinical trials, before beginning my PhD at the School of Paediatrics and Child Health at the University of Western Australia in 2011.
My PhD research was about cellular and soluble antimicrobial proteins in preterm mothers' milk, and how these contribute to protection of preterm infants against bacterial infection. I have since moved into the field of respiratory medicine, investigating the interaction of bacteria with host airway epithelium and the use of bacteriophages to treat lung infections in children with cystic fibrosis.
